Audit Item 9: Deep-Link Routing (Glimmerpath mobile app). Confirm that all registered deep-link patterns resolve to valid in-app destinations and that fallback web routes fire when the app is absent. Support staff should test the top twenty link templates each quarter, recording failures in the Thornby tracker with screenshots. Expired campaign links must be retired, not redirected. Route any routing anomalies to the owner identified below.

named custodian: Brivan Eliath Quenox Frador

Hi everyone,

As flagged at the offsite, we're moving ahead with outsourcing tier-one customer support to Calvera Response from October. To be clear: this covers phone and chat triage only — complaints and warranty claims stay in-house with your teams. Expect a transition workshop in September, and please start logging recurring query types now so the handover scripts are solid. Nobody is losing headcount; affected staff move to the retention desk. There's one piece of this we're keeping within this group for now.

confidential, yajof-fahif: The board signed off on a budget of $130.3 million for Project Norok.

## Deployment

EchoDocent (the audio-guide app for the Hallowmere Museum) ships as a single container behind the Gatehouse proxy. Deploys happen via the `release` pipeline — don't push images by hand, the kiosks in the west wing cache aggressively and will serve stale audio for hours. After a deploy, spot-check one exhibit tour end to end. Support folks: if playback breaks, compare the running pod's config against the values shown below.

service settings:
[silwyn]
host = silwyn.crelvogrid.internal
user = silwyn_svc
database = silwyn_prod

- [ ] **Step 7: Breaker override escrow.** After sealing the signing keys for the Tallgrove upstream API circuit breaker, confirm the support team can force the breaker open during a full outage. The override bundle lives in the sealed escrow drawer and is useless without its unlock phrase. Two ceremony witnesses must initial this step before proceeding. The escrow bundle is decrypted with the recovery passphrase that follows.

vault phrase of kahip-kahop = holath-quenmir